Anagram Partners advised Goldman Sachs Alternatives and its portfolio company Omega Healthcare Management Services in an investment by Ontario Teachers’ Pension Plan (OTPP). With this investment OTPP will join Goldman Sachs Alternatives as co-lead investor in Omega Healthcare.
Founded in 2003, Omega Healthcare works with healthcare institutions to empower them to deliver exceptional care while enhancing financial performance. Omega aims to help its clients increase revenues, decrease costs, and improve the overall patient experience through their comprehensive portfolio of technology-enabled and clinically led solutions.
Goldman Sachs is one of the leading investors in alternatives globally, with over $500 billion in assets. The business invests in the full spectrum of alternatives including private equity, growth equity, private credit, real estate, infrastructure, sustainability, and hedge funds.
OTPP is a global investor with investments in more than 50 countries covering assets such as public and private equities, fixed income, credit, commodities, natural resources, infrastructure, real estate and venture growth.
Anagram Partners acted as the legal advisor to Goldman Sachs and Omega Healthcare on the Indian law aspects of this transaction. The team was led by our Partners, Simone Reis and Rajesh Simhan and comprised Shwetank Chaubey, Anupam Nayak and Anand Unnikrishnan.
